Karangahake Gorge
The Karangahake Gorge Historic Walkway follows the old Paeroa-Waihi railway line through the gorge above the Ohinemuri River.It passes historical features associated with the gold fields. Beside the walkway can be seen the remains of mine buildings and machinery,including stamper batteries used to extract gold from quartz. The walkway gives a fascinating glimpse of the history of a major gold producing area that operated from 1875 to 1952.
Karangahake Gorge is between Paeroa and Waihi, with access via State Highway 2. There are three points of entry to the walkway, at Karangahake; Owharoa Falls, off Waitawheta Road; and at the Waikino Historic Station and Visitor Centre.
